> Believe me or not, very few people accepted. Surprisingly for me.
In a way, there's a selection bias: most of these employees already knew that they could get more in the same company by just relocating to a US office, and that it's not that hard to do. If they were still in Europe at this point, it meant that they had real reasons to stay.
